Got a problem with one of my little Cornish cross chicks. It had a case of pasty butt today, and the little girls got it cleaned up. But this evening it's butt is all swollen and pink, and feels plump, like a balloon. I rodded it out, so to speak, with the tip of a q-tip. It seems to be in distress, it just wants to lay and pant and not walk around.. Is there anything I can do for this chick, besides just put it out of its misery?
